Transaction 1cf8c6ed1a521004053500034f0c86fdf29ae2c4db074853d351cb1ff15185c5
1 Input
1 Output
-
1cf8c6ed1a521004053500034f0c86fdf29ae2c4db074853d351cb1ff15185c5:0
- value
- 3476845
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 698ba150b44443882c61e68c911f121e29e5a658 OP_EQUAL
- address
- 3BK69MiZ94Z4mpcJeG2tqBej6Wwmsu1naP